  • User-Friendly
    Blogger is known for its simple, user-friendly interface, making it easy for beginners to start blogging without technical knowledge.
  • Free Hosting
    Blogger offers free hosting, so users do not need to worry about hosting fees or managing a server.
  • Integration with Google Services
    Blogger is owned by Google, which allows seamless integration with other Google services like AdSense, Google Analytics, and Google Drive.
  • Custom Domain Support
    Users can link their custom domain names to their Blogger accounts, helping them establish a more professional online presence.
  • Strong Security
    Being a Google product, Blogger benefits from robust security measures and a reliable uptime.

Possible disadvantages

  • Limited Customization
    Blogger offers fewer customization options compared to other platforms like WordPress, which can limit creative control for advanced users.
  • Basic Features
    The platform has basic blogging features and lacks the extensive range of plugins and themes available on other platforms.
  • Less Professional
    While it is great for personal blogs, Blogger is generally considered less suitable for professional and business websites.
  • Template Constraints
    The predefined templates may not meet the specific needs of all users, and customizing them can be challenging without coding knowledge.
  • Potential for Discontinuation
    As a free Google service, there is always a risk that it could be discontinued or significantly changed, impacting long-term bloggers.
  • Automated Moderation
    CommentMod offers automated moderation of comments, helping to manage large volumes of interactions efficiently without manual intervention.
  • Customizable Filters
    Users can create custom moderation filters to fit their specific needs, allowing for a personalized moderation experience.
  • Real-Time Monitoring
    Provides real-time monitoring of comment sections, ensuring that inappropriate comments are addressed swiftly.
  • Integration Capabilities
    CommentMod integrates with several content management systems and platforms, making it easy to incorporate into existing workflows.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The platform features a user-friendly interface that simplifies setup and operation, reducing the learning curve for new users.

Possible disadvantages

  • Cost
    CommentMod might come with licensing or subscription fees, which could be a factor for budget-conscious users.
  • Limited Free Version
    If there is a free version, it may have limited features compared to paid tiers, which could constrain users who don't opt for premium plans.
  • Potential Over-Moderation
    Automated systems might accidentally flag or remove legitimate comments, which could result in unnecessary disputes.
  • Dependence on Algorithm
    Relies heavily on algorithms to moderate content, which may not perfectly understand context, especially in nuanced comments.
  • Privacy Concerns
    Some users might have concerns over data privacy, as moderation services often require access to comment data.

Overall verdict

  • Blogger is a good platform for those who are just starting out in blogging and are looking for a straightforward and cost-effective solution. However, it may not be the best choice for more advanced users who require extensive customization options or advanced functionality.

Why this product is good

  • Blogger is a free and user-friendly blogging platform that is ideal for beginners who want to start their own blog without any technical expertise. It is owned by Google, which means it integrates well with other Google services, such as AdSense and Google Analytics. Additionally, it offers reliable hosting and a simple setup process, making it easy to create and publish blog posts quickly.

Recommended for

    Blogger is recommended for individuals who are new to blogging, writers who want to share their thoughts with a small audience, and users who prefer a platform with little maintenance and no hosting costs.
